Paper Selection
In the art of origami grass, selecting the appropriate paper type and color plays a crucial role in achieving the desired aesthetic and realism. The choice of paper affects factors such as the grass’s texture, durability, and ability to hold its shape.
- Paper Weight:
The thickness of the paper influences the grass’s sturdiness and ability to stand upright. Heavier paper is more rigid, while lighter paper is more flexible and can create a softer, flowing look. - Paper Texture:
The texture of the paper can add depth and realism to the grass. Papers with a rough or textured surface can create a more natural look, while smooth papers may give a cleaner, stylized appearance. - Color and Shade:
The color of the paper determines the grass’s overall hue. Opting for shades of green that closely resemble natural grass, such as emerald, olive, or forest green, can enhance realism. Experimenting with different shades within the green spectrum can create variations in the grass’s appearance. - Paper Finish:
The paper’s finish can affect the overall look and feel of the grass. Glossy paper can create a shiny, reflective surface, while matte paper has a more subdued, natural finish. The choice of finish depends on the desired effect and the project’s context.
Matching the paper’s characteristics to the intended result is key in origami grass creation. Considering factors like paper weight, texture, color, and finish allows for customization and personalization of the grass to suit various project themes, styles, and environments.
Folding Techniques
In the art of origami grass, folding techniques hold the key to creating realistic and visually appealing grass blades. Mastering these techniques allows for the manipulation of paper to achieve the desired shape, texture, and overall appearance of grass.
- Base Folds:
The foundation of origami grass lies in the base folds, which determine the overall structure and shape of the grass blade. Common base folds include the square fold, triangle fold, and bird base. - Pleating and Tucking:
Pleating and tucking techniques add depth, texture, and realism to the grass blades. Pleats create sharp creases, while tucks introduce curves and organic shapes. - Curving and Shaping:
Curving and shaping techniques allow for the manipulation of the paper to create bends and curves that mimic the natural growth patterns of grass blades. This can be achieved through folding, rolling, or pinching the paper. - Fringe and Detailing:
Fringe and detailing techniques add the finishing touches to the grass blades, creating the illusion of individual blades and enhancing the overall realism. This can be done by cutting or tearing the edges of the paper or adding small folds and creases.
Understanding and mastering these folding techniques empowers the creator with the ability to craft origami grass that closely resembles the natural world. By combining different techniques and experimenting with variations, one can achieve unique and personalized results, bringing their origami grass creations to life.
Coloring and Shading
In the art of origami grass, coloring and shading play a vital role in bringing life and realism to the creations. By incorporating color and shading techniques, one can elevate the visual appeal of the grass, making it appear more natural and immersive.
- Color Selection:
Choosing the right colors is essential for creating realistic origami grass. Opting for shades of green that closely resemble natural grass, such as emerald, olive, or forest green, enhances the overall authenticity of the creation. - Color Application:
The method of color application can significantly impact the final appearance of the grass. Techniques such as painting, coloring pencils, or markers can be used to apply color evenly or create textured effects. - Shading and Highlights:
Adding shading and highlights to the grass blades can create a sense of depth and dimension. This can be achieved by using darker and lighter shades of green or by employing techniques like dry brushing or stippling. - Color Variation:
In nature, grass often exhibits variations in color and tone. Incorporating color variation into origami grass can enhance realism and make the creation more visually interesting. This can be done by using different shades of green or by adding hints of other colors, such as yellow or brown.
Coloring and shading techniques allow the creator to customize the appearance of the origami grass, matching it to the specific environment or theme of their project. By experimenting with different colors, application methods, and shading techniques, one can create unique and visually striking origami grass creations that captivate the viewer’s attention.
